引言
在开源软件的世界里,GitHub是一个重要的平台,拥有海量的项目和代码。为了跟踪您关注的项目,GitHub提供了RSS功能,使用户能够更方便地获取项目的最新动态。本文将深入探讨如何使用GitHub的RSS功能来跟踪项目更新,帮助您高效地获取所需信息。
什么是RSS?
RSS(Really Simple Syndication)是一种Web内容分发的标准格式,允许用户获取更新而无需访问网页。它适用于许多网站,包括新闻网站、博客以及GitHub等代码托管平台。
为什么选择GitHub的RSS功能?
使用GitHub的RSS功能可以为用户带来许多好处:
- 实时更新:用户可以及时获取项目的最新信息。
- 节省时间:不必手动检查每个项目的更新,自动接收通知。
- 个性化订阅:可以根据个人兴趣选择订阅不同的项目或仓库。
如何查找GitHub项目的RSS链接?
1. 访问项目页面
首先,您需要访问您关注的GitHub项目页面。举个例子,如果您关注的是某个开源库,比如octokit
,您可以通过搜索或者直接输入网址来找到它。
2. 获取RSS链接
在项目页面上,您可以找到相应的RSS链接,通常是在项目的更新部分。它的格式一般是:
https://github.com/用户名/仓库名/commits.atom
替换用户名
和仓库名
为您感兴趣的项目的实际值。
3. 复制链接
将找到的RSS链接复制下来,以便后续使用。
如何使用GitHub RSS链接?
1. 使用RSS阅读器
您可以选择使用RSS阅读器,如Feedly、Inoreader等,来接收来自GitHub的更新。
- 在RSS阅读器中,点击“添加新订阅”或“+”号。
- 将复制的GitHub RSS链接粘贴到订阅框中。
- 确认订阅,等待RSS阅读器拉取数据。
2. 通过浏览器查看
如果您不想使用第三方应用程序,许多现代浏览器也支持RSS功能。您只需将RSS链接粘贴到浏览器地址栏中,浏览器将为您显示最新的更新。
常见的GitHub RSS链接示例
以下是一些常见的GitHub RSS链接示例,帮助您更好地理解如何获取更新:
- 用户的所有仓库更新:
https://github.com/用户名.atom
- 特定项目的更新:
https://github.com/用户名/仓库名/commits.atom
- 关注者活动:
https://github.com/用户名/following.atom
通过RSS跟踪多个项目
如果您关注多个项目,可以将所有项目的RSS链接添加到同一个RSS阅读器中,便于集中管理。这能帮助您避免在多个页面之间切换,从而提升效率。
GitHub的RSS与API的区别
虽然GitHub的RSS功能非常方便,但如果您需要更为复杂的交互和数据提取,可以考虑使用GitHub的API。API提供了更强大的数据访问功能,适合开发者进行深度集成。具体区别如下:
- RSS:主要用于获取最新动态,内容固定。
- API:可进行多种数据操作,如查询、提交等。
FAQ
GitHub的RSS功能是否免费?
是的,GitHub的RSS功能是免费的,任何用户都可以随意使用。
我可以订阅私有仓库的RSS吗?
私有仓库的RSS链接需要相应的权限,只有被授权的用户才能订阅和访问。
使用RSS订阅需要技术背景吗?
不需要,RSS订阅非常简单,您只需获取链接并添加到阅读器即可。
如何确保我的RSS阅读器接收到最新更新?
大多数RSS阅读器会自动刷新并获取最新内容,如果您发现未更新,可以手动刷新。
结论
GitHub的RSS功能是跟踪项目动态的一个有效工具,能为开发者和爱好者提供便利。通过了解如何获取和使用这些链接,您可以更轻松地管理您感兴趣的项目,及时获取更新。如果您还没有尝试使用GitHub的RSS功能,现在正是一个好时机!